Intelligent dual mode Bluetooth modules target industrial and medical applications
The fully approved, programmable module features the company’s event-driven smartBASIC programming language, which significantly reduces OEM development risk and speeds time to market. The BT900 series allows anyone to easily and quickly add wireless capabilities to their embedded device such as a barcode scanner, portable medical device, and more.
What makes the BT900 series unique is smartBASIC, an event-driven programming language that enables hostless operation of the module, significantly reducing the overall BOM cost of the OEM product. Laird has extended the field proven implementation of smartBASIC from the popular BL600 and BL620 series of single-mode BLE modules into the latest BT900 series. This allows developers the flexibility of utilizing smartBASIC’s Core and wireless Extension functions from the BL600 and BL620 series to create many interchangeable BLE applications between these two product ranges.
Key application areas for the BT900 series include industrial cable replacement, medical devices, ePOS terminals and barcode scanners for portable, power-conscious devices, including those powered by batteries.
Without the need for any external processor, a simple smartBASIC application captures the complete end-to-end process of reading, writing, and processing of any data which then uses Classic Bluetooth or BLE to transfer it to or from any Bluetooth device.
In addition to carrying FCC modular, IC, CE, and MIC approvals, BT900 modules are fully qualified as a Bluetooth product, enabling designers to integrate the modules in devices without the need for further Bluetooth testing.
